Output fba61ec6494e6e17581f7fc800779584a11d0f1a292008c7632e33400bd7859a:0

value
2615711
script pubkey
OP_0 OP_PUSHBYTES_20 ce4dcdb0a10ee2fd2f19dd489a6fb8f416255757
address
bc1qeexumv9ppm306tcem4yf5mac7stz246hq3zgpq
transaction
fba61ec6494e6e17581f7fc800779584a11d0f1a292008c7632e33400bd7859a
spent
true